Originally posted by nis350ztt
No. The driveshaft is good for over...1000whp I believe. The half-axle shafts is what breaks. Driveshaft Shop has a stage 2 and stage 5 half-axle upgrade. The stock is good to 617rwhp so far, SGP Racing's customer car has that much hp and hasn't done anything to the half shaft. I imagine you'd want it though if you are going to take it to the track and launch it hard.

I'm having SGP racing build the motor.. they are one of the only places I know that uses a torque plate when boring out the cylinders.. CJ motorsports does as well. This is something I believe is almost necessary as it will allow them to bore out the cylinder under torque load.. if they dont do this there could be minor warping.. not a good thing runnin near 7k rpms...
